SQL创建表后默认无数据,学会插入操作让数据入住
创始人
2024-12-24 11:03:32
0 次浏览
0 评论
sql创建表后,表内存在数据吗?
在SQL中,创建表后,默认表中没有数据。创建表时,仅在数据库中创建一个表结构,其中包含字段名、数据类型、约束等信息,但表中不存储实际数据。
如果要向表中添加数据,需要使用INSERTINTO语句将数据插入到表中。
例如,以下是创建表并插入数据的示例:创建表:CREATETABLEexample(idINTPRIMARYKEY,nameVARCHAR(50),ageINT);插入数据:INSERTINTOexample(id,name,age)VALUES(1,'John',25),(2,'Mary',30),(3,'Tom',28);这样才能看到表中的数据
SQL中如何插入数据?
插入表名(字段名用逗号分隔(不用写自动增长的列))值(对应的值也用逗号分隔)
如果每个字段都需要进行插入时,可以写成
insertinto表名值(按顺序写入值,每个字段都要写(不包括自动增长列))
into即可省略
insertinto语句可以写成两种形式:
1.插入数据不需要指定列名,只需提供要插入的值即可:
insertintotable_name
values(value1,value2,value3,...);
2.您需要指定列名和插入的值:
insertintotable_name(column1,column2,column3,...)
values(value1,value2,value3,...);
扩展信息
常用SQL语句
查看所有数据库showdatabases;
创建数据库createdatabasedb1;
查看数据库showcreatedatabasedb1;
创建数据库指定字符集createdatabasedb1charactersetutf8/gbk
删除数据库dropdatabasedb1;
使用数据库usedb1;
创建表createtablet1(idint,namevarchar(10));
查看所有表showtables;
查看单表属性showcreatetablet1;
查看表字段desct1;
创建指定引擎和字符集的表createtablet1(idint,namevarchar(10)))engine=myisam/innodbcharset=utf8/gbk;
相关文章
高效替换MySQL字段内容:两种方法助你...
2024-12-18 07:03:55C语言字符数组比较方法解析与技巧
2024-12-16 13:56:07MySQL root密码忘记?4招轻松解...
2024-12-20 15:38:49MySQL 5.7 vs 8.0:深度解...
2024-12-17 19:39:05SQL Server 2008编辑前20...
2024-12-24 04:07:26掌握SQL UPDATE语句:高效修改数...
2024-12-15 03:31:44MySQL 5.5下载与安装指南
2024-12-16 12:03:40Redis集群模式深度解析:主从复制、哨...
2024-12-19 12:23:26MySQL基础教程:轻松掌握建库建表操作
2024-12-15 09:41:08CMD操作教程:轻松实现MySQL远程登...
2024-12-20 12:45:05最新文章
24
2024-12
24
2024-12
24
2024-12
24
2024-12
24
2024-12
24
2024-12
24
2024-12
24
2024-12
24
2024-12
24
2024-12
热门文章
1
SQL2000数据库备份压缩技巧:优化空...
怎么将SQL2000中的较大的备份数据库压缩变小更改数据库属性-选项-恢复模型很...
2
高效掌握:CMD命令轻松启动、关闭及登录...
如何用cmd命令快速启动和关闭mysql数据库服务开发中经常使用MySQL数据库...
3
SQL字符串处理技巧:单引号使用与转义标...
SQL语句中,字符串类型的值均使用什么符号标明?单引号如果字符串内有单引号,请小...
4
Windows环境下Redis安装指南与...
redis安装windowsredis基本简介与安装安装Redis首先需要获取安...
5
深度解析:Redis性能优势与局限性,助...
redis有哪些优缺点?Redis的全称是RemoteDictionary.Se...
6
深入解析:MySQL数据库的特性与应用
mysql是什么MySQL是一个关系数据库管理系统。MySQL是一个开源关系数据...
7
SQL字符串转日期:CONVERT()函...
sql字符串转换成日期将SQL字符串转换为日期;您可以使用CONVERT()函数...
8
SQL多表查询连接方式解析:内连接、外连...
SQL多表查询的几种连接方式。WHERE条件:在带有ON条件的SELECT语句中...
9
一招轻松掌握:如何快速查看MySQL版本...
查看MySQL版本一步轻松搞定看mysql版本MySQL是一种关系数据库,有许多...
10
Python字符串格式化方法:.form...
格式化字符串是什么意思吸引力从某种意义上说,一个软件项目包含了大量与数据(尤其是...